The influence of concentration of HCO-_3 ions was discussed by comparison of cyclic voltammetric behaviors of X70 steel in solutions of different concentrations of HCO-_3 ions.A prepassive film was formed with the presence of HCO-_3 ions.The stability of prepassive film was reduced with increasing of HCO-_3 ions.The formation of Fe(Ⅱ) species governed the electrochemical behavior of prepassive process.HCO-_3 ions appeared to play the dominant role in the initial dissolution of Fe.The structure of prepassive film was confirmed by XRD and IR.The film had double-layer structure.Fe(OH)_2 as the composition of inner layer deduced with the increasing of concentration of HCO-_3 ions,while FeCO_3 on the outer layer increased.
